Guest guest Posted June 11, 2008 Report Share Posted June 11, 2008 Hi Dede,I don't use specific measurements because I try to make it to taste good enough for the kids and the recipe is for a small quantity. Patty has the actual recipe. All I do is mix organic coconut oil baking soda xylitol peppermint essential oil until it seems like a nice consistency and tastes good. My teeth feel cleaner after using it than any other toothpaste I've ever used. Oh, and I forgot to mention that since using it the number of spirochetes (a really bad bacteria) in my mouth decreased a ton according to a microscopic exam they gave me. Before they said I had a dangerous level, this time they had a hard time finding any.The only problem I've had is that the consistency is so thick it's hard to squeeze from a bottle so I dip it out of a tupperware cup which is not very hygenic. My dental hygenist suggested getting a cake frosting bag w/ cap. Hope you're hanging in there Dede. Thinking about you. Love, PH >> PH or Patty ~> Can you post the recipe for > the toothpaste ? ?
